    Smile Coupe des Alpes 2014 (June 11-14)

    Still time to sign up for the above rally, no regularity trials, no racing, just a 3-day fast driving run from Evian to Cannes.

    http://www.rallystory.com

    This event is loads of fun for those who enjoy driving through the Alpes, and spend some time sharing their Porsche (or other classics) passion.

    We'll be there with quite a few cars and friends this year through our team "Ecurie Lyford".
